2. Consent and Opt‑In
- You must provide express consent (opt-in) to receive SMS messages from The CAZA Group, whether
via web form, verbally, or otherwise. Consent must be specific, unambiguous, and documented.
- For promotional messages, we require express written consent—for example, through a web form or equivalent means.
- For transactional or conversational messages initiated by you (e.g., appointment or support requests), implied consent may apply.
- If you sign up for recurring messages, we will send an opt-in confirmation message confirming
your subscription, message frequency, and how to opt out.

5. Message Content Restrictions
Our messages never include prohibited content such as:
- High-risk financial services (e.g., loans, debt collection, cryptocurrency)
- Get-rich-quick schemes or deceptive marketing
- SHAFT content: sex, hate, alcohol, firearms, tobacco
- Phishing, scams, profanity, pornographic, or other disallowed content
6. Registration & Compliance
To ensure deliverability and compliance:
- We register all messaging campaigns with The Campaign Registry (TCR) as required for U.S. A2P
10‑DLC messaging.
- We maintain campaign registration and approval status via our admin dashboard before sending
messages.
